Carswell, Carol Frances was born on March 5, 1939 in Brooklyn. Daughter of Jacob S. and Shirley (Brecher) Rubin.
Associate of Applied Science in Secretarial Skills, Brooklyn College, 1959. Bachelor in Economics, Brooklyn College, 1968. Master of Science in Education, St. John's University, 1973.
Postgraduate, Queens College, 1980.
Assistant credit manager, bookkeeper, Arista Trading Company. New York City, 1958-1959; executive secretary, Lehn and Fink Products Corporation, New York City, 1959-1961; office manager, legal secretary, Vladeck, Elias, Vladeck, and Engelhard, New York City, 1961-1966; teacher, City of New York, 1967-1972, 1975-1976; teacher, Farmingdale (New York) High School, 1972-1973; staff accountant, Holtz, Rubenstein & Company, Certified Public Accountant's, Melville, New York, 1979-1981; private practice accountant, Sebastian, Florida, 1982-1984; finance director, City of Sebastian, since 1984.
Board directors Sebastian Area County Library, 1983-1984. Treasurer, board directors American Red Cross, Indian River County, Florida, 1984-1985. Board directors local chapter American Cancer Society.
Member Florida Government Finance Officers Association, Florida Municipal Treasurer's Association (board directors), Pilot of Sebastian River Club (treasurer 1987-1988).
